Watson-Gum Grove Cemetery

Gum Grove Community, Kingsland, Cleveland Co., AR.

Transcribed and Surveyed by: Joe Watson    Email: watson11ej@yahoo.com

Typing and Design by: Edith (Watson) Marks    Email: watson10ej@yahoo.com

 

DIRECTIONS: From Kingsland, take Highway 189 North, travel 4.1 miles, make a sharp right turn onto gravel road, travel .9 mile, turn right onto dirt road, travel .1 mile to the cemetery.

NOTE: We gave the grave rows letters to help with the survey, there are no signs.  As you walk in the gate, Row A would be the first row from the left (West) fence, reading from back (North) fence to front (South) fence on each row.
